Ох и много времени прошло с момента публикации второй стратьи из цикла “Аналитик и…”. Но ничего, мы наверстаем. На этот раз в фокусе — эксперт в предметной области (subject matter expert, SME). По роду своей деятельности бизнес-аналитику доводится взаимодействовать с SME если и не постоянно, то весьма часто. Причем в роли эксперта (а это именно роль, а не должность) может выступать любое заинтересованное лицо. Отсюда и потенциальные трудности, с которыми может столкнуться аналитик. Но, как всегда, обо всем по порядку.
Кто такой эксперт в предметной области?
Пожалуй, не будем в третий раз рассуждать на тему, кто такой аналитик, а начнем сразу с SME. Итак, согласно Википедии, эксперт в предметной области, вы не поверите, — это “тот, кто является экспертом в той или иной области или теме”. Этого весьма развернутого определения (как, в общем, и названия), конечно, вполне достаточно, чтобы сформировать у себя примерное понимание того, какую роль эксперт играет в проекте: это тот человек, который обладает знаниями в области бизнеса, технологий или любой другой области, полезной для проекта, и может описать процессы и результаты этих процессов.
Из возможных активностей SME можно выделить следующие:
- участие в интервью для предоставления аналитику всей необходимой информации;
- проверка требований на полноту, правильность, осуществимость и недвусмысленность;
- участие в приемочном тестировании
Экспертами в предметной области часто выступают конечные пользователи продукта. Тем не менее важно понимать, что это бывает не всегда: к примеру при разработке CRM системы для логистической компании экспертом может выступать начальник отдела логистики. Он обладает достаточными знаниями и опытом, чтобы предоставить необходимые бизнес-требования. Аналитик также сможет зафиксировать все бизнес-правила, но поскольку начальник отдела не является конечным пользователем, он, вероятно, не сможет помочь в проектировании интерфейса также эффективно, как это сделает рядовой опытный сотрудник, которому предстоит работать с данной системой.
Что ожидает эксперт от аналитика?
- аналитик не будет впустую тратить время эксперта;
- аналитик знает хоть что-то из предметной области эксперта;
- аналитик будет внимательно фиксировать всю полученную информацию, чтобы потом, через какое-то время, не получилось, что аналитик (или кто-нибудь другой из этой же команды) придет с таким же вопросом;
- задачи, поставленные к нему, как к эксперту, будут четко очерчены аналитиком.
Какие ожидания от эксперта у аналитика?
- эксперт обладает необходимыми знаниями и опытом в предметной области;
- если речь идет о принятии каких-то решений, то эксперт может принимать решения самостоятельно, либо процесс их утверждения четко поставлен и не займет много времени;
- эксперт будет доступен для контактов и будет своевременно отвечать на вопросы;
- эксперт сможет при необходимости принимать участие в приемочном тестировании;
- эксперт положительно настроен по отношению к самому проекту, к будущим результатам проекта и к команде проекта.
Сложности взаимодействия
Одной из задач бизнес-аналитика является извлечение максимального количества требований, полезных для проекта, и их дальнейший анализ. Зачастую для этого выделяется не так много времени, как хотелось бы, и эффективно проведенные встречи с экспертом становятся весьма важными. Чтобы с первых этапов взаимодействие было успешным, следует изучить кандидатуру эксперта еще до начала совместной работы. Не стоит выслеживать человека по вечерам, чтобы узнать, чем он занимается. Но чем больше информации о человеке вы будете знать заранее, тем более вероятно, что вы наладите с ним контакт и получите возможность узнать все, что вам нужно, в максимально короткие сроки. Довольно полезно будет узнать, что именно знает эксперт, какие средства общения (встречи, телефонные звонки, письма и т.д.) предпочитает, когда и на сколько доступен, насколько самостоятельно эксперт может принимать решения, какими полномочиями обладает и, наконец, насколько эксперт действительно эксперт.
Не все SME одинаково полезны. Конечно, ситуации бывают разные, и аналитик может продолжать играть мать Терезу и молча собирать фрагменты требований у бедного новичка, которого начальник предложил в качестве эксперта. Но в таком случае проиграют все. В этом случае мы можем посоветовать обратиться к начальству с соответствующей рекомендацией, а когда это невозможно, хотя бы поставить их в известность о возможных рисках.
Однако и с матерыми опытными профессионалами все может быть не так просто. Эксперт, обладая огромными знаниями и недюжинным опытом, будет употреблять узкоспециализированную терминологию, жаргонизмы, раздражаться на ваше непонимание или отсутствие знаний, пропускать важные моменты, думая, что они очевидны. Что можно посоветовать в данном случае? Не бойтесь показаться глупыми и переспрашивайте, если что-то не поняли. Объясните, что вы новичок в данной предметной области, а он — гуру, и именно поэтому вы к нему и пришли.
Что делать, чтобы все были довольны?
Давайте разделим всю нашу работу с экспертом на небольшие итерации, каждая из которых будет иметь 3 обязательных этапа: планирование, взаимодействие, анализ и корректировку. Все просто. Что это нам даст? Во-первых, можно будет хотя бы примерно планировать свои активности, что уже неплохо. Во-вторых, вы не будете выглядеть глупо в глазах эксперта, если заранее подготовитесь. В-третьих, это поможет не потерять важную информацию, которую вы не успеете зафиксировать (а вы не успеете — это ведь эксперт, он много знает). В итоге получилось очень похоже на метод PDCA.
Этап 0. Узнайте больше об эксперте и установите положительный контакт.
Этап 1. Планирование
- Не стоит начинать встречу с SME, не подготовившись. Практически всегда можно найти время, чтобы сначала изучить информацию из различных источников (хорошо работает правило “Аналитик сначала гуглит, а потом спрашивает”).
- Изучите существующую документацию, прототипы.
- Подготовьте вопросы заранее.
- Узнайте, позволят ли вам записать предстоящее интервью (будет весьма полезно, когда будете разбираться в своих записях после интервью и ломать голову, что же вы все-таки записали).
- Подготовьте бумагу и ручку (или что-нибудь еще, чем привык пользоваться эксперт) для того, чтобы эксперт смог наглядно описать процессы, нарисовать модели и т.д.
- Уточните, какие у вас цели и задачи, опишите круг вопросов, которые собираетесь задать, чтобы эксперт мог также заранее подготовиться.
Этап 2. Взаимодействие
- Убедитесь, что эксперт знает, что вы цените его время и желание поделиться с вами информацией.
- Не забудьте записать разговор, если получили на это разрешение.
- Можете напомнить эксперту, что знаете весьма мало из его области.
- Постарайтесь ограничить темы разговора до нужных вам. Эксперт знает гораздо больше и может думать, что все будет полезно для проекта.
- Используйте техники и методики извлечения требований (5 Why?, Root-cause analysis (для разнообразия — Ishikawa diagram), построение контекстной диаграммы, прототипирование), а не просто болтайте с экспертом о жизни. (Вот уж, где действительно пригодится BABOK)
- Делайте заметки.
- Постарайтесь убедить эксперта рисовать диаграммы и модели, если это поможет вам понять и структурировать информацию.
- Слушайте. (Это, безусловно, важный навык аналитика, как, впрочем, и внимание к невербальным и паралингвистическим аспектам.)
- Определите наиболее удобную форму дальнейшего общения и уточнения ваших вопросов, которые наверняка появятся после интервью.
Этап 3. Анализ
Если по окончании интервью вам кажется, что ваш мозг скоро взорвется от полученного объема новой информации, все в порядке. Скорее всего, после интервью вам захочется перечитать свои записи и структурировать всю информацию в голове для запоминания.
- Перечитайте ваши записи и устраните пропуски.
- Оформите записи так, чтобы можно было разобраться в них и через месяц.
- Прослушайте запись разговора. Возможно, вы что-то пропустили.
- Во время документирования и создания прототипов соберите все вопросы в список. Когда количество вопросов будет достаточным, отправьте данный список эксперту. Это сэкономит ему время.
Этап 4 (опциональный). Корректировка
Если интервью с заинтересованным лицом не является единственным, а только одним из нескольких, то весьма целесообразно проанализировать не только полученные требования, но и сам процесс интервью. Это поможет лучше подготовиться к следующему этапу, а именно, планированию очередной встречи с данным заинтересованным лицом.
Заключение
Взаимодействие с экспертом в предметной области, как и с любым другим заинтересованным лицом, требует от аналитика развитых коммуникативных навыков. Но импровизация хороша, только если это “подготовленная импровизация”. Подготовка и последующий анализ позволяют повысить эффективность данного взаимодействия. Эффективная коммуникация всегда оправдана, а иногда позволит вам еще и вырасти в глазах своего начальника, если, скажем, эксперт будет весьма лестно отзываться о вашей работе. Поэтому развивайтесь, но не забывайте и про этическую сторону общения.
Предыдущие статьи:
2. «Аналитик и» Проектный Менеджер
Я бы предложил еще одно определение эксперта — это человек, который расскажет вам (аналитику) о том, что и почему невозможно в его предметной области.
Пожалуй, это самая интересная информация, которую может предоставить эксперт аналитику. Ведь самые интересные решения лежат как раз за границами возможного :)